COMMUNITY NEWS

  • StepUp Wilmington is hosting 'Jazz and Generosity' on Nov. 9 to support community empowerment, featuring Grammy-nominated Damion Murrill.  WECT
  • Dunkin’ Donuts celebrates the grand opening of its new Wilmington location by offering free coffee for a year to the first 100 customers and donating $5,000 to Special Olympics of North Carolina.  Port City Daily

CRIME NEWS

  • Yuhanna Muhammad McCallum was sentenced to up to 7 years and 9 months in prison for leading a check-kiting scheme that cost two credit unions more than $130,000.  WECT

ECONOMY NEWS

  • Topsail Steamer secured an investment deal to expand its business after its founder presented on 'Shark Tank', focusing on growing sales and direct-to-consumer efforts.  Wilmington Star-News

EDUCATION NEWS

  • Voting opens for StarNews Student of the Week, highlighting exceptional students from New Hanover, Brunswick, and Pender counties for their academic achievements and community contributions.  Wilmington Star-News
  • UNCW's Society of Women Engineers and first-year engineering students collaborated on a wave flume boat race to fundraise for a conference, aiming to make it an annual learning event.  WWAY

LIFESTYLE NEWS

  • Halloween 365 in Wilmington sees a surge in customers seeking popular costumes like Ghost Face, Deadpool, and Wolverine just days before Halloween.  WWAY
